Browned and Baked Falafel

Browned and Baked Falafel is a wonderful recipe! So full of amazing nutrition and deliciousness. Falafel are often deep fried or at least in a lot of oil in your frying pan. These are quickly browned in a bit of oil and then baked so you get the crispy outside and the soft amazing inside. These can be served in a pita with a load of other things - hummus, tzatziki, greens/spinach, cooked or pickled beets, caramelized or oven roasted onions, and tahini as in the photo – or on a bed or rice with a salad on the side. When in a pita, it can get a bit messy as you devour this goodness, but aren’t the best things in life a little messy? Eat these with wild abandon!

Cauliflower Alfredo Linguini

Made with cauliflower, this Alfredo recipe lightens up the original and results in a healthy, thick, garlicky tasty sauce. This recipe makes a generous amount and half the sauce is perfect for 250g of linguini, fettuccini or any other pasta you wish and you will have remaining sauce for another pasta night or to add to a wrap or sandwich or to toss roasted diced sweet potatoes in. Decadent 3 Ingredient Mousse au Chocolat

There are loads of recipes out there for aquafaba chocolate mousse with loads of ingredients and long instructions. I narrowed the base recipe down to 3 ingredients and a few instructions. You can add a splash of vanilla, a teaspoon of instant coffee or espresso powder, a bit of cinnamon, some white or dark chocolate bits, top with a drizzle of caramel, chocolate shavings, berries… so many delicious possibilities. It’s a decadent treat for a special evening or to spoil someone special – like yourself! Super simple and super delicious!
